Ubisoft finalmente parcheó la incompatibilidad de los orígenes de CA y Valhalla con Windows 11

Bienvenido de nuevo a nuestra serie de actualizaciones "¿Cómo está Ubisoft hoy?" En medio de los desafíos continuos que enfrentan la alta gerencia de Ubisoft, hay un rayo de noticias positivas para compartir. La compañía ha abordado con éxito un problema irritante que ha estado afectando a los jugadores durante meses.

Ubisoft ahora ha resuelto los problemas de compatibilidad entre varios títulos de Assassin's Creed y la actualización de 24H2 para Windows 11. Desde el otoño de 2024, juegos como Assassin's Creed Origins y Assassin's Creed Valhalla, junto con otros títulos de Ubisoft, experimentaron problemas de rendimiento significativos en el nuevo sistema operativo. La solución? Parches frescos que se implementaron y anunciaron en las páginas de vapor para Origins y Valhalla.

La comunidad de juegos ha respondido con entusiasmo en la sección de comentarios de las notas del parche. Muchos jugadores están expresando su gratitud a Ubisoft por la tan esperada solución, particularmente señalando que esta vez el problema surgió de Windows, no en Ubisoft. Si bien el sentimiento es positivo, las revisiones recientes para ambos juegos aún se ciernen en "Mixed".

Mirando hacia el futuro, hay optimismo en torno a la próxima sombra de Assassin's Creed. Su lanzamiento ha sido reprogramado al 20 de marzo, un movimiento estratégico de Ubisoft para mejorar la calidad del juego. El éxito de este lanzamiento es crucial, ya que bien podría dar forma al futuro de la empresa.
